Staff Member of the Month – Ms. Harvey

Ms. Harvey is an essential member of the BLT Academic Team, helps lead her PLCs with confidence and clarity, and consistently shows school pride to both students and staff. She is a strong, dedicated teacher on the 2nd grade team who always puts students first. We are grateful for her commitment to our school community and proud to recognize her as our Staff Member of the Month.
